'The Upper Delaware', 1874. 'Above Callicoon; Pond Eddy; Below Deposit', views of the Delaware River, New York State, USA. The town name of Deposit was derived from the deposits of logs made by lumbermen. The timber was formed into rafts to float down the Delaware River to feed the factories. From "Picturesque America; or, The Land We Live In, A Delineation by Pen and Pencil of the Mountains, Rivers, Lakes...with Illustrations on Steel and Wood by Eminent American Artists" Vol. II, edited by William Cullen Bryant. [D. Appleton and Company, New York, 1874]
